What is Ferrous Glycine Sulphate?

Ferrous glycine sulphate is a compound that combines iron (ferrous) with glycine, an amino acid. This chelation process not only stabilizes the iron but also improves its solubility and absorption in the gastrointestinal tract. Unlike traditional iron supplements, which can often lead to gastrointestinal discomfort, ferrous glycine sulphate is known for its gentler impact on the stomach.

The Mechanism of Absorption

The absorption of ferrous glycine sulphate occurs primarily in the small intestine. Here’s how it works:

1. Chelation Process: The glycine component binds to the ferrous iron, creating a stable complex. This chelation protects the iron from inhibitors that can be present in the diet, such as phytates and polyphenols, which often hinder the absorption of traditional iron supplements.

2. Increased Solubility: The solubility of ferrous glycine sulphate in the acidic environment of the stomach enhances the release of iron ions. This increased solubility facilitates better absorption in the intestinal lining.

3. Transport Mechanisms: Once absorbed, ferrous iron is transported across the intestinal wall through specific transport proteins. The presence of glycine aids in the uptake process, ensuring that a higher percentage of iron enters the bloodstream compared to other forms of iron.

Benefits of Ferrous Glycine Sulphate

1. Enhanced Bioavailability: Studies have shown that ferrous glycine sulphate has a higher bioavailability compared to traditional iron supplements, meaning that a greater amount of iron is effectively absorbed by the body.

2. Lower Gastrointestinal Side Effects: One of the main complaints associated with iron supplementation is gastrointestinal discomfort, including constipation and nausea. Ferrous glycine sulphate, due to its unique formulation, is generally better tolerated, making it a suitable option for long-term use.

3. Support for Overall Health: Adequate iron levels are crucial for various bodily functions, including the production of hemoglobin, energy metabolism, and immune function. By improving iron absorption, ferrous glycine sulphate can support overall health and well-being.

4. Versatile Usage: This supplement can be beneficial for various populations, including pregnant women, athletes, vegetarians, and individuals with chronic illnesses that may lead to iron deficiency.
